WebSep 2, 2024 · The Snow crabs have a very high reproductive potential. Each single female crab carries eggs each year. A female crab can carry up to 150,000 eggs under their abdomens after mating. And the females are fertilized internally. The male crabs are capable of mating at both immature and mature stages of their lives.
